Master to Rock Climb: Techniques and Safety Tips

Ready push your limits? Rock climbing is an exhilarating sport that combines physical strength, mental focus, and problem-solving skills. If you're a complete beginner or have some experience, there are essential techniques and safety tips to ensure a rewarding and safe climbing journey. Kick off by mastering fundamental skills including footwork, body positioning, and rope management.

  • Always to inspect your gear thoroughly for any damage or wear and tear.
  • Hone your climbing skills on beginner walls before tackling more challenging ones.
  • Pay attention to experienced climbers and instructors for valuable tips and advice.

{Remember, safety should always be your top priority. Utilize a properly fitted harness and helmet, and never climb alone. Climbing with a partner provides essential support and security.
